rabbitmq安装与配置
2016-07-11 20:03
204 查看
RabbitMQ的安装和简单配置
RabbitMQ的说明和特性见官网http://www.rabbitmq.com/features.html
安装(参考官网http://www.rabbitmq.com/install-generic-unix.html):
从官网下载http://www.rabbitmq.com/releases/rabbitmq-server/v3.6.2/rabbitmq-server-generic-unix-3.6.2.tar.xz
然后xz -d rabbitmq-server-generic-unix-3.6.2.tar.xz ,之后用tar -xvf 解压 rabbitmq-server-generic-unix-3.6.2.tar (注意:使用tar -zxvf解压报错,将参数z去除就行)
使用sbin目录下的 ./rabbitmq-server -detached 可能是报错: exec: erl: not found,此时需要安装Erlang环境,可以参考(http://www.51itong.net/linux-rabbitmq-mysql-redis-apache-930.html ; http://blog.csdn.net/huoyunshen88/article/details/34438715 ;http://yidao620c.iteye.com/blog/1947335);
安装Erlang可能会报错,请参考 http://blog.csdn.net/chszs/article/details/28638305;
可以在etc/profile.d中新增一个erlang.sh的文件,添加上erlang的sbin的路径,然后source /etc/profile;
上面的安装容易出错,采用rpm方式安装可能会顺利,具体参考
http://www.cnblogs.com/flat_peach/archive/2013/03/04/2943574.html
http://www.rabbitmq.com/install-rpm.html
简单介绍:
rabbitmq:
faout:这种模式下不需要 routing-key
direct:这种模式下,queue 需要执行 bind 操作绑定到 Exchange 上并提供绑定的 routing-key
topic:这种模式比较复杂,简单的来说,就是 Exchange 会把收到的消息转发到所有关心 routing-key 的 queue 上,Exchange 通过对消息的 routing-key 进行模糊匹配查找到对应的队列
参考:
http://techlog.cn/article/list/10183005
发布订阅是使用topic还是faout,如何做权衡?
RabbitMQ的说明和特性见官网http://www.rabbitmq.com/features.html
安装(参考官网http://www.rabbitmq.com/install-generic-unix.html):
从官网下载http://www.rabbitmq.com/releases/rabbitmq-server/v3.6.2/rabbitmq-server-generic-unix-3.6.2.tar.xz
然后xz -d rabbitmq-server-generic-unix-3.6.2.tar.xz ,之后用tar -xvf 解压 rabbitmq-server-generic-unix-3.6.2.tar (注意:使用tar -zxvf解压报错,将参数z去除就行)
使用sbin目录下的 ./rabbitmq-server -detached 可能是报错: exec: erl: not found,此时需要安装Erlang环境,可以参考(http://www.51itong.net/linux-rabbitmq-mysql-redis-apache-930.html ; http://blog.csdn.net/huoyunshen88/article/details/34438715 ;http://yidao620c.iteye.com/blog/1947335);
安装Erlang可能会报错,请参考 http://blog.csdn.net/chszs/article/details/28638305;
可以在etc/profile.d中新增一个erlang.sh的文件,添加上erlang的sbin的路径,然后source /etc/profile;
上面的安装容易出错,采用rpm方式安装可能会顺利,具体参考
http://www.cnblogs.com/flat_peach/archive/2013/03/04/2943574.html
http://www.rabbitmq.com/install-rpm.html
简单介绍:
rabbitmq:
faout:这种模式下不需要 routing-key
direct:这种模式下,queue 需要执行 bind 操作绑定到 Exchange 上并提供绑定的 routing-key
topic:这种模式比较复杂,简单的来说,就是 Exchange 会把收到的消息转发到所有关心 routing-key 的 queue 上,Exchange 通过对消息的 routing-key 进行模糊匹配查找到对应的队列
参考:
http://techlog.cn/article/list/10183005
发布订阅是使用topic还是faout,如何做权衡?
相关文章推荐
- 【Hibernate 7】浅谈Hibernate的缓存机制
- hdu1172猜数字
- Android中自定义控件的步骤
- select()
- HIVE点滴:group by和distinct语句的执行顺序
- HTML5基础学习笔记(五)
- 欢迎使用CSDN-markdown编辑器
- org.eclipse.jdt.core.prefs
- 给input文本框添加灰色提示文字
- 文章标题
- 哪些设计模式是降低资源使用率:----腾讯2016研发工程师笔试题(一)
- 前言介绍
- BZOJ3155 Preprefix sum
- java 集合类Array、List、Map区别和联系
- 我对DrawerLayout的了解
- POJ-1953-World Cup Noise
- C/C++遍历Lua中的table
- ScrollView与Listview滑动冲突解决
- android studio生成get和set方法
- 数据库索引的实现原理